Service
In order to solve their possible disputes, C.A.M.P. offers to parties engaged in international maritime trade:
- An organization and arbitration Rules which have stood the test of time.
- A list of about 50 independent arbitrators having experience in professional fields (as commercial maritime practitioners, jurists or maritime experts).
- A simple and fast procedure at a reasonable cost.
We also offers to the parties:
- A permanent Secretariat in charge of the procedure.
- Rooms for hearings with easy access located.
16, Rue Daunou, 75002 Paris, in the center of the city close to The Opera house.

The Chambre Arbitrage Maritime de Paris publishes ”La Gazette de la Chambre” in French three times a year in January, April and September. It can be downloaded from the website.
The last awards summaries have been translated in English and can be read in the last Gazette issue.
The whole awards summaries can be found in “Documentation”.
